Output 3ddf9623de1f01c69b976be05ee652044a7bf8cb39406d42d8a9f9d8ebec405d:0

value
1476227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f7744f5060d13f888ec98d8e1b26a911ee4666f OP_EQUAL
address
38wCBgLWute1i11XXDy8yiFKBmjSjCcgks
transaction
3ddf9623de1f01c69b976be05ee652044a7bf8cb39406d42d8a9f9d8ebec405d
spent
true